feature: south african artist ohyeslord’s vibrant illustrations
I’ve been a fan of OHYESLORD’s work for a while, and when I thought of the idea to start an online mag/blog he was one of the first people to come to mind that I could possibly feature, so I was very excited when he agreed. Born in Pretoria and now based in Jahannesburg, OHYESLORD is self-taught, which I would have never guessed had he not mentioned it. His style of illustration is very unique and on a high standard when it comes to digital illustration. His ability proves that talent is most important when it comes to art and that studying art isn’t always an advantage over other people within the same industry. I hope you like and appreciate his work as much as I do.
By Sabelo Mpum, AFROPUNK Contributor *
“OHYESLORD is an alias I use to represent my graphical and illustrative work; the craft I’m passionate about. The name comes from how people usually give praise…just like how people shout “AMEN” after the pastor gives a good sermon or “HALLELUJAH” when they’re feeling the verse, so exists “OHYESLORD” which is me giving praise for discovering what I’m passionate about.” – OHYESLORD
